How much energy can you save?

Do you know about Earth Hour?  On March 31st at 8 pm local time, Earth Hour will be observed?  As we are growing in our concern for the earth and its resources, we have a chance to make a difference.  If every household would turn off the lights for one hour on March 31st over 16,610 tons of carbon would not be consumed.  The sum effect is that resources would be conserved, the atmosphere and our lungs will be relieved of the task of cleaning the residue out of the air and it will be saved for another day.
    What else could you do at 8:00 pm on March 31 to add to the health of our planet?  Plant some spring flowers, get the early lettuce and other vegetables in your garden?  Or just take a hike to enjoy the longer day!   Make your contribution to wise stewardship of resources.
